Kingsman: The Secret Service Review 8/10
Every year there are a few films that fly under the radar. I'm not talking about the Oscar nominated films that are released in select cities and then a month or so later are released for the public. I'm talking about films that you just want to sit back and enjoy and instead walk away much happier than anticipated. Kingsman: The Secret Service is the first of 2015 for me.
With the right amount of action and comedy, the director Matthew Vaughn delivers a film that most people of the genre will love. It's very violent and at times over the top. But the movie doesn't take itself seriously and after an intense scene the comedic timing by the actors are perfect.
Because a young boys father saved a "Kingsman", this particular character played by Colin Firth, vows to watch over him. This leads to bringing the boy to train to be the next "Kingsman". But first he must beat out around 10 other candidates. The series of tests that the recruits are put through are thrilling scenes to watch.
The fight choreography gets better throughout the movie including a massive fight in a church and the final fight near the end. I enjoyed this more than I thought I would and would highly recommend it to anyone who likes action/comedy. I would also just recommend it to anyone who enjoys good movies. A solid 8/10

Birdman Review 8/10
If you're a fan of film and you love to watch movies then I highly suggest this movie. The performances delivered by the actors is quite simply some of the best I've seen in recent memory. What also makes these performances even better is the way this film was shot. It looked like it was one continuous shot from beginning to end so the actors had to be on point the entire time. One mistake and they have to go back 10 minutes to fix it.
The story is about a former actor who writes, stars and directs his own play. He wants to feel relevant again after doing three "Birdman" films. This is a homage to Michael Keaton playing Batman long ago. There are things that happen in this film that might confuse you but just go with it and it'll all makes sense in the end.
Once again, the acting is brilliant and the story is interesting along with quite a few hilarious scenes. A pleasant surprise for me and one that I highly recommend.

John Wick Review 7/10
An ex-assassin loses his wife to cancer, her last gift to him is probably the worlds cutest dog. This lasts for maybe a day or two as a couple young punks break into his home, kill his dog and steal his car. Turns out the guys who did this too him is the son of his former boss. Now you learn throughout the movie that John Wick is known by just about everyone in town. So why this kid didn't know who he was is dumb but its what makes the story take off.
John Wick is an action film that you need to just sit back, watch and enjoy. Don't nitpick at the little things. Such as the dialogue being a little bit corny, or the many cliche's that occur. This movie has fantastic gun fight choreography. In my opinion, its in the top 10 for gun fights. I also liked the world they created. The world of contract killers was different from what I had seen in the past.
The good guy is a likeable character and you feel for him. You also despise the bad guys especially the son. Bottom line, its a good time and if you like action films, I highly recommend it.

Chef Review 8/10
This didn't get much publicity or mainstream press but under a
recommendation from a friend I was happy to learn that this is movie
many people should watch. It has an all star cast led by Favreau, the
director himself.
Some complaints I've read are about how they overuse twitter and social
media, almost like they are advertising it. I disagree and believe that
it was essential to the story. A chef receives a terrible review by the
most acclaimed food critic in the country. The review blows up on
twitter so with the help of his son, he creates his own account. When
he responds to the critic via twitter, he thinks he has only privately
messaged him when in reality the whole world can see what he wrote.
The other part of the story is the relationship he has with his son and
ex-wife. In my view, the underlying story is to pursue what you love.
Don't let anyone tell you what to do, if you have a dream go and make
it happen. As long as you're happy, life is good. With a solid cast and
enough comedy to keep it lighthearted, I highly recommend this film.
